摘 要:目的比较脐带间充质干细胞(UC-MSCs)与脂肪源性间充质干细胞(AD-MSCs)的体外生物学特性。方法分离培养UC-MSCs与AD-MSCs,CCK-8法检测UC-MSCs与AD-MSCs的增殖能力,流式细胞术检测细胞表面标志物表达。油红O,茜红素及Von Kossa染色比较UC-MSCs与AD-MSCs成脂成骨诱导分化能力。MSCs与外周血单个核细胞(PBMC)共培养,在植物血凝素(PHA)刺激作用下,流式细胞术分析MSCs对PBMC增殖抑制作用。结果生长曲线结果显示,UC-MSCs细胞增殖优于AD-MSCs,UC-MSCs与AD-MSCs稳定表达CD13、CD44、CD73及CD90分子,不表达CD34和CD45。AD-M SCs成脂能力优于UC-M SCs,但成骨能力没有明显差异。UC-M SCs抑制PBM C增殖能力优于AD-M SCs。结论 UC-M SCs在免疫调节方面是一种更佳的种子细胞选择。Objective To study the biological characteristics of mesenchymal stem cells( MSCs) derived from human umbilical cord and adipose in vitro. Methods Umbilical cord-derived mesenchymal stem cells( UC-MSCs) and adiposederived mesenchymal stem cells( AD-MSCs) were isolated. Cell growth curve was detected using CCK-8 method,and cell surface antigens were measured using flow cytometry. The adipogenic and osteogenic differentiation assays were analyzed by Oil Red O,Alizarin Red S and Von Kossa staining. The immunomodulatory properties of UC-MSCs and AD-MSCs on lymphocytes were evaluated through the co-culture assay with PHA activated adult peripheral blood monocuclear cells( PBMCs). Results Cell growth curve showed that UC-MSCs proliferated more rapidly than AD-MSCs.Flow cytometry analysis showed that UC-MSCs and AD-MSCs were positive for CD13、CD44、CD73 and CD90,andnegative for CD34 and CD45. AD-MSCs had the stronger adipogenetic ability than UC-MSCs,but there were no difference on osteogenetic ability between these two cells. UC-MSCs has the stronger suppression effects on PBMC proliferation than AD-MSCs. Conclusion UC-MSCs are the more attractive cell population for usage in immune cellular therapy.
